Description
English: 1966-08. Corporal Trevor Winterton of Deception Bay, Qld (left), and Sergeant John Ellis of Ipswich, Qld, load Cessna aircraft of 161 (Independent) Reconnaissance Flight with 2.75 inch white phosphorous rockets used for target indication during air strikes.
